Output bb50da60aeb0f9cd97a4d72d60152863b4523bbeb82094aa10a02329fbaabbeb:5
- value
- 595434076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e58799a2b8f5f82dfc0b2604e790a59854420c32 OP_EQUAL
- address
- 3Ncf78pxtiL2qEdmHesQ66bVg4WLQ1rt41
- transaction
- bb50da60aeb0f9cd97a4d72d60152863b4523bbeb82094aa10a02329fbaabbeb